To start with, the genus - -Trigonidium - -was designated with -type -species - -Trigonidium cicindeloides - -from -Spain -, Europe. The subgenus - -Trigonidium -( -Trigonidium -) - -was later proposed by -Gorochov (1987) -. At present, it is doubtful whether all Australian species assigned to - -Trigonidium - -actually belong in - -Trigonidium - -sensu stricto -at all ( - -Tan -et al. -2019 - -). Several closely related genera and subgenera were designated based on the presence or absence of auditory tympana on the anterior tibiae and of a stridulatory apparatus in males ( -Otte & Alexander 1983 -). Examples are the subgenera - -Trigonidium -( -Metioche -) - -, - -Trigonidium -( -Balamara -) -Otte & Alexander, 1983 - -, - -Trigonidium -( -Parametioche -) -Otte & Alexander, 1983 - -, and the genus - -Trigonidomorpha - -. Because acoustic communication has been lost several times independently in crickets, some of these genera are likely to be polyphyletic ( -Otte & Alexander 1983: 197 -; - -Chintauan-Marquier -et al. -2016 - -; -Rentz & Su 2019: 316 -; - -Tan -et al. -2019 - -). To complicate things, different morphs with or without auditory tympana can appear in the same species ( -Ingrisch 1977 -; -Rentz & Su 2019 -). - - -It is outside of the scope of this work to resolve the wider systematics of -Trigonidiinae -in the Australian region. Based on the strong similarities between - -Trigonidium -( -Trigonidium -) -maoricum - -and - -Trigonidium -( -Trigonidium -) -cicindeloides - -and on the analysis of molecular data ( -Fig. 31 -), I am confident that - -T. maoricum - -belongs to the genus - -Trigonidium - -s. str. -The genus - -Trigonidomorpha - -is synonymised here with - -Trigonidium -( -Trigonidium -) - -. - \ No newline at end of file diff --git a/data/03/A4/75/03A47546FFD97C4A65451D36FD88D705.xml b/data/03/A4/75/03A47546FFD97C4A65451D36FD88D705.xml new file mode 100644 index 00000000000..87b155171ab --- /dev/null +++ b/data/03/A4/75/03A47546FFD97C4A65451D36FD88D705.xml @@ -0,0 +1,196 @@ + + + +Small crickets of New Zealand (Orthoptera: Grylloidea: Trigonidiidae and Mogoplistidae), with the description of two new genera and species + + + +Author + +Hegg, Danilo +34DFC18A-F53D-417F-85FC-EF514F6D2EFD +Wētā Conservation Charitable Trust, 135 Blacks Road, Ōpoho, Dunedin 9010, New Zealand. +danilo@wetaconservation.org.nz + +text + + +European Journal of Taxonomy + + +2024 + +2024-09-09 + + +955 + + +1 + + +1 +87 + + + + +https://europeanjournaloftaxonomy.eu/index.php/ejt/article/download/2655/12275 + +journal article +10.5852/ejt.2024.955.2655 +2118-9773 +13742408 +5D22E144-EF73-4085-9774-E853EEEC6001 + + + + +Tribe + +Trigonidiini +Saussure, 1874 + + + + + + +Remarks + + + +Trigonidiinae +in the Australian region include a number of genera and subgenera that have been giving taxonomists headaches for decades.
